Logic for using pagination in listview
So I am currently developing a flutter app that uses a Django Rest Framework backend. So far everything has been great but I am confused about implementing pagination in my listview builder. This is the typical response I get from my api:
HTTP 200 OK { "count": 1023 "next": "https://api.example.org/accounts/?page=5", "previous": "https://api.example.org/accounts/?page=3", "results": [ … ] }I get a count that gives me the number of objects, the next page url and the previous page url. The next is null if we are on the last page and previous is null if we are on the first page.I already have the scroll controller for listview figured out so I don't need help with that.I just want to get your thoughts on my logic and see if there is a better way to implement this.I have basically decided to store the current index, previous index, and the next index in the provider and use them to update the url that gets requested to the API.Every time there is a get request to the API, we check and see if next is null in the response body and if it isn't we set the next index in the provider as current index+1.If next is null in the response body then we set next index to null and we don't try to request any more pages.If the next index is not null then when we are reaching towards the end of our current list we set prev index to current index, current index to next index, and the value of next index to null temporarily. We make a get request to the url and add the results to our list. The value of next index is updated if the response shows that we have more pages.If the listview is refreshed then we set prev to null, current to 1, and next to null. We completely clear the list and assign the new results.

Handling transparent status- and navigation bars
Hello Flutter developers,Have any of you guys had any experience with changing the system status- and navigation bars to transparent, to allow your apps content to take up as much screen estate as possible?It is fairly easy to simply import SystemChrome and SystemUiOverlayStyle from the services.dart file, and then using that to set the bars to transparent. However with this method I found some problems with the systems icons as they would have to change their brightness according to the brightness of the app, which can both be changed from within the app with a toggle or a button, but also system wide from the system toggle of dark mode (which utilises the darkTheme parameter of the MaterialApp). This doesn't seem to be a problem if you don't have a transparent status- and navigation bar, seeing as the icons always have a background then.What I did to solve this was to create a stateful class that implements the WidgetsBindingObserver and then using that class to set the icon brightness according to the brightness of the app, whether the brightness is controlled by a button in the app itself, or if it has been triggered from the system toggle (which is the main reason for this class, as I haven't found any other ways to react to brightness changes from the system toggle).I'm wondering if having an observer at the top of the widget tree listening to phone changes to change the system icon brightness is a bad practice or not? What have you guys done to solve this issue? I'll happily share the class I've made with you if you want to see it.
